Answer:

The IUPAC name of the organic compound is :

2,6-Dimethyl octane

Step-by-step explanation:

How to name the compounds:

1. First, search for the longest carbon chain.Here 8-C chain is the longest chain.(Octane)

2. The numbering of Carbon is done such that the branched chain get minimum number.(From right side the -CH3 group less number[2] but from left side it get number [6] )(2,6-dimethyl)

3. If different alkyl chain are attached then naming is done in alphabetical order. Here -CH3 is the side chain appearing at position 2,6

4. If the identical groups are present then Their position numbers are separated by comma's. and prefix di ,tri , tertra is placed.

Here 2 methyl groups are present (-CH3)

So the name is 2,6-Dimethyl octane
